    Active control of a stalled airfoil through steady or unsteady actuation jets

    The active control of the leading-edge (LE) separation on the suction surface of a stalled airfoil (NACA 0012) at a Reynolds number of 106 based on the chord length is investigated through a computational study. The actuator is a steady or unsteady jet located on the suction surface of the airfoil. Unsteady Reynolds-Averaged Navier–Stokes (URANS) equations are solved on hybrid meshes with the Spalart–Allmaras turbulence model. Simulations are used to characterize the effects of the steady and unsteady actuation on the separated flows for a large range of angle of attack (0<a<28 deg). Parametric studies are carried out in the actuator design-space to investigate the control effectiveness and robustness. An optimal actuator position, angle, and frequency for the stalled angle of attack a¼19 deg are found. A significant increase of the lift coefficient is obtained (+84% with respect to the uncontrolled reference flow), and the stall is delayed from angle of attack of 18 deg to more than 25 deg. The physical nonlinear coupling between the actuator position, velocity angle, and frequency is investigated. The critical influence of the actuator location relative to the separation location is emphasized

    Relevance Of Reduced Tillage Practices On Soil Biological, Chemical And Physical Quality And Ecosystem Services Under Organic Farming Context In Britany

    Avoiding or limiting ploughing under organic farming management remains a big challenge for organic farmers. By developing an holistic approach, the aim of this study was to evaluate the impact, under organic farming management, of different tillage techniques on soil biological, physical and chemical quality and ecosystem services. In an experimental site located in Britany (France) four tillage techniques were compared: conventional ploughing (CP), agronomic ploughing (AP), superficial non-inversed tillage (C15) and very superficial non-inversed tillage (C8). Results, obtained during 10 years (from 2003 to 2013), showed a strong temporal variability between years, however some results appeared consistent. Positive impact of reduced tillage on hydraulic conductivity and organic matter content was limited to the 0-5 cm depth. No-inversed tillage (C15, C8) and agronomical ploughing (AP) significantly improved microbial biomass. C8 is the only technique which significantly decreased nematofauna. Earthworm biomass significantly decreased under conventional ploughing (CP) due to the decrease of anecic species while ploughing techniques (CP, LA) preserved total earthworm abundance due to endogeic species. Endogeic species had a negative impact on hydraulic conductivity whereas anecic enhanced the conductivity and Carbon and Phosphorus contents. No-inversed tillage techniques (C8, C15) leaded to a decrease of the crop yield, due to an increase of weeds which increased water and nutritive competition. This study highlighted the interests and limits of no-inversed techniques and agronomical ploughing applied in organic farming management for enhancing soil quality and crop yield

    Le château de Neuville-sur-Ailette (Aisne) : état des recherches

    International audienceLe site du château de Neuville a fait l’objet de deux diagnostics complétés par des recherches documentaires et des observations de surface en dehors de l’emprise des deux opérations archéologiques.Les vestiges imposants d’un bâtiment médiéval ont été dégagés. Cette construction aux caractéristiques monumentales appartient au château de Neuville. Réoccupé pendant la Première Guerre mondiale par l’armée allemande, ce bâtiment a fait l’objet d’un réaménagement intérieur et un dessin y a été peint. Pilonné pendant ce conflit, il a ensuite en grande partie été remblayé.Une restitution du tracé de l’enceinte castrale a été proposée. La confrontation des différents résultats nous a également amené à réfléchir à l’implantation du château construit au lendemain des guerres de Religion en remplacement de l’ancienne forteresse médiévale.L’emprise du cimetière qui s’étendait dans l’espace situé entre l’église et le château a enfin été partiellement circonscrite. L’une des tombes fouillées indique une occupation relativement précoce de cet espace funéraire dans les années 1170-1268
